read the original abstract
Kerr black hole immersed in test, asymptotically homogeneous magnetic field, aligned along the symmetry axis, is described by Wald's solution. We show how the static case of this solution may be generalized for nonlinear electromagnetic models via perturbative approach. Using this technique we find the lowest order correction to Wald's solution on Schwarzschild spacetime in Euler--Heisenberg and Born--Infeld theories. Finally, we discuss the problem of highly conducting star in asymptotically homogeneous magnetic field.
